===Part 2=== They were not far from the First District... or they should be. On a desolate mountain trail with no vegetation growing, Ragna, devoid of energy to stand up anymore, sat down with his back placed against a big rock. Even though his body was grazed many times against magic effects and received a shock wave to his stomach, the damage received from the continuous kicking was the most severe. He rubbed his hurting forehead while he watched what was on the other side. There were Celica and seemingly her sister of a witch with the pointy hat. They were both quarreling and sometimes even shouting. It was hard to say that the atmosphere was gentle. But he judged that there wasn't a tiny speck of anything serious that couldn't be mended. They seemed to be close sisters. Ragna was at loss on how many times he had sighed. He had been completely out of the loop from some time ago. "Here you go." A gentle voice approached him from his side. It was the woman with glasses holding out a small plastic cup. Its contents was herb tea, which she blended herself. Thin white vapor was rising. He wasn't particularly appropriate with the likes of herb tea, but Ragna was thankful to receive it. There was an unusually refreshing aroma there. Although there was no water around the wasteland, it didn't really make the spectacled woman concerned in getting hot water since she had magic. He didn't have anything against magic, but even when he knew that it was harmless to drink it, he still had complicated feelings about it. [[Image:BB_P0_137.jpg|thumb]] The spectacled woman sat beside Ragna. She charmingly gazed at the sisters who were a bit separated from them. "Please forgive her for suddenly intruding. When it comes to her sister, she will just disregard anything on her surroundings." "You saw it, huh?" A little while ago, his body realized it directly. "Well, it's just because Celica is very important to her, right? ...I know she's being overprotective, but I've got problems with that." Ragna spoke before sipping his tea while the spectacled woman giggled. "Just like Celica-san said, you're very gentle, Ragna-san." "What do you mean...? I don't get it." "Ufufu. You're so shy." As expected, the spectacled woman was viewing Celica and her older sister as if looking at playful kittens. Then, she took a sip of the warm tea. "My name's Trinity~. And that girl is Nine. As you may already know, she's Celica-san's big sis." "Nine?" "Of course, it's not her real name. She's currently the ninth of the Mage’s Guild's Ten Sages. Therefore, she's called Nine." "Hmm. I see." It was a fitting reaction toward it, but Ragna's response didn't mean that he felt the name was unusual. Nine. The Six Heroes defeated the Black Beast, and among them, there was someone named Nine. If that was the case, then she was probably... "It's actually just a title. But it seems Nine isn't that fond with her real name~." "The reason's probably her old man, huh?" As Ragna muttered, Trinity bitterly smiled while furrowing her eyebrows. On the opposite side, the usual tension could be heard from the voices of Celica and Nine. In regard to Celica's serious pleading of ''Ragna isn't a bad person!'', Nine said her opinions like ''it's not good being together with a man that has doubtful origins, let alone when he's no less than small fry'', or, ''isn't it like picking up a dirty animal?''. At any rate, they were horrible things to say. Trinity listened to that conversation while charmingly smiling and sipping her own cup. "When she discovered that Celica-san had gone to find her father, Nine was in a panic. She always and always searched for her." "Well, it's her sister's nature after all. Of course she'd be worried." He didn't know what other things she was capable of, but her handicap of not having any sense of direction had burdened them so that they were barely able to reach the mountain near the port. It might have been not less than a miracle for them to have been able to get there. "That's why a while ago she entered the mountain, relying on the powerful magic that had suddenly occurred. When she finally came across Celica-san, Nine felt so relieved. But when she saw a man she had never seen together with her sister, she was sooo surprised. ...And then, she felt a little determined." "The meaning of her determination was different." Despite Trinity grinning as sweet as sweet pastry, Ragna wondered why he sensed a dangerous aura the moment he said those words. "That, too, was because of her feelings for Celica-san. Please excuse her~." "I'm not that angry. But it sure was painful." His forehead still hurt. There might still be shoe marks there. "...Though, I know that she's just worried about her sister." "Oh my. Does Ragna-san have siblings, too?" "Nope. I still can't remember about that clearly." Celica had already told Nine and Trinity about when he was unconscious and the amnesia he got. His memories were certainly coming back little by little. His mind especially felt clear immediately after he went to the Alucard residence. Nonetheless, there were still many blurry parts. He tried to absorb the meaning of the word 'sister' which Trinity had said repeatedly. Did he have a younger sister? Or maybe a younger brother? Either way, their existence was surely important. "Why!? Why are you so against me searching for Father!?" Celica's loud voice came in suddenly. Before anyone noticed, the conversation went from talking about Ragna to Celica searching for her father. Until now, Celica's tensed face was stiffening. She fixed her eyes on the sister that was a little taller and had a composed face. "Don't you worry about Father? Japan has been like this for six years, but still no one knows where Father is or whether he's alive. It's weird!" "It's a rare occurrence for someone to be alive if they're in Japan when the Black Beast appeared. Many people have been missing for a while, and now they're treated as if they've died. Even you should understand it, right?" "But there were survivors!" "It's just a coincidence. It's meaningless to find him." "That's not true! At least, I want to know if he's in good health, or if I'm not able to meet him anymore..." "And how will you do that!?" Nine's voice became harsh. The piercing tone of voice blocked Celica's reply back in her throat. However, her staring eyes didn't flinch. She wasn't that weak of a younger sister. Rather, as the one who seriously shouted, it was Nine who was flinched as she dropped her gaze. To calm herself down, she took a deep breath. "And what if he's alive? After you're satisfied with meeting that man again, are you going to return home together with him?" "No. It's not like that. Not at all..." Even after she had regained her composure, Nine didn't hide her irritation. Celica desperately tryied to get the right words as she shook her head forcefully. Her long hair danced around. "I just want to find him. If he turns out to be okay, then that's enough. If he's injured and in poor condition, then I'll heal him. And once again... Father will become like his former self and try his best to do lots of research for the better of society. I'm fine with just that." "...For the better of society, huh." Averting her eyes, Nine let out a short breath. Immediately, Celica's face was dyed in anxiety. But before she asked something, a third voice interrupted them. "Nine. If you scold Celica-san that hard, wouldn't you feel sorry for her?" It was Trinity. Before anyone noticed, she had stood between the two sisters. Just like when she interfered with Ragna and Nine who were fighting each other... or rather a one-sided violence. "If only you spoke more honestly. Like, 'I was very worried. I'm glad you're okay'..." "What do you mean? That's what I've been saying until now." "You didn't say it." Since Nine was too haughty with her reply, Ragna unconsciously let his mouth to interrupt her. At that moment, a frightening gaze eyed him. "...Ahem. Anyway, if you just wander aimlessly in Japan, you won't reach your goal. There's a nuclear attack, and stuff similar to Black Beast fragments remained all over the place. Don't do futile efforts anymore. Let's get home already." Folding her arms below the voluptuous bosom, Nine made a statement while trying to be careful not to make her tone sound harsh. Nevertheless, there were glimpses of irritation in every word she said. Like Trinity had said, Celica must have been anxious and troubled. Even Celica fully understood her intention. However, the younger sister shook her head stubbornly. "I don't want to give up yet." "Celica!" "Anything's fine. I can accept anything that happened... but I want to know what's going on with Father. If I don't put this to an end, I'll keep worrying about Father forever. I might also drag someone down." Celica crossed both of her hands in front of her chest. "Even if the worst case happened, I'll accept it completely. It's better than being clueless like this. ...I want to properly know what happened to Father." If in the end nothing would be gained, rather than keep wishing for unseen things, it's better to have something visible stolen away. Of course, it would be ideal if that visible something within their arms could return. Celica's voice was confessing as if she were praying. Her chest seemed to be suffocating. Unable to stay quiet, Ragna stood up. He took Clavis' map that Celica had been holding in her hand and presented it to Nine. She must have been gripping it tightly. It was crumpled. "An acquaintance told us to go there since there might be some clues. We're already close to it. Only a bit more, so let her be satisfied." Nine didn't seem amused. But she took back her previous blatant hostility and looked at the presented map. Still crossing her arms, she didn't move her hands. "...The First District, hm?" "Do you recognize it, Onee-chan!?" "The vicinity was nothing but a place related to Black Beast." Nine spoke, looking a bit uncomfortable. The reason was simple. Ragna asked her about it. "You're aware that your old man's got something to do with Black Beast, huh?" "Eh!?" said Celica as she let her voice out. Celica stared at her older sister with a surprised look on her face. Nine didn't give a nod, but with an affirmative expression she answered. "...The one who investigated it was the Mage’s Guild, after all. It's natural." A mere ordinary pupil like Celica might not be able to know about it, but it was a different case for a member of the Ten Sages like Nine. One could only wonder just how much information she had obtained which didn't make it to the public. "So that's why you don’t want Celica to get close with her old man." "You just happened to pass by. Don't act like you know everything. I felt discontent towards that man's researches in the past." As if rejecting him, Nine averted her face from Ragna. Feeling completely annoyed, she then sighed and brushed up her long hair. "As I thought, you're trying to trick her after all. I don't know from whom you got this, but he gave you a useless map." Even with those kind of words, her tone of voice revealed that she had given up. "...This the last time. If we don't find any clues after examining the First District, we'll take it that the man has died. Then we'll go home, okay?" Nine stressed it while pointing her well-treated fingertip. It was the utmost bargain she could give. Even when Celica was a bit hesitant, she gave a big nod since it was better than to shake her head and get dragged home. "Yup. Got it." "Well then, what are we going to do~?" "Hmph. You already know it, Trinity." At her friend's prompt of a smile, Nine spoke with a disappointed tone. Her rolled up sharp eyes were looking to Celica in resignation. "Since it's you we're talking about, you'll probably get lost. I'll take you until the First District, so put away that useless map." Averting her face suddenly, Nine turned her back from Ragna and Celica. Contrary to her harsh words, the movement of her hair, which was long enough to reach her hips, was graceful. Celica looked at Ragna with a delightful face. Then, she leaped to reach the arm of her sister who had turned her back. "Thank you, Onee-chan!" "This is reaaaaaaally the last time I do this." "I know, I know." The sisters were talking as they returned to where they had come. As for Ragna and Trinity, both were giving a pleasant but bitter smile at the scene. Just as they had expected, the sisters were going back to the same ruined mountain trail.
